  • Speed
    StackBlitz is known for its quick load times and fast editing capabilities, making it ideal for rapid development and testing.
  • Ease of Use
    The interface is intuitive and user-friendly, allowing developers to get started quickly without a steep learning curve.
  • Zero-Setup
    Users can write, compile, and run code directly in the browser without any setup or configuration required.
  • Integrations
    StackBlitz integrates seamlessly with GitHub, allowing for easy import and export of repositories.
  • WebContainers
    StackBlitz uses WebContainers to run Node.js applications in the browser, providing a near-native development experience.
  • Collaboration
    Real-time collaboration features allow multiple users to work on the same project simultaneously, similar to Google Docs.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Plugins
    Unlike traditional IDEs like VSCode or IntelliJ, StackBlitz has a limited ecosystem of plugins and extensions.
  • Online Dependency
    StackBlitz requires an internet connection to function, which can be a limitation for developers who need to work offline.
  • Performance
    For very large projects or those requiring extensive computational resources, performance may degrade compared to local development environments.
  • Mobile Accessibility
    While StackBlitz is accessible on mobile devices, the user experience is not as optimized as it is on desktop browsers.
  • Limited Framework Support
    Although StackBlitz supports many popular frameworks, it doesn't support all frameworks or versions, which could be limiting for some projects.
  • Storage and Persistence
    Files and data are stored in the cloud, which might raise concerns around data privacy and persistence for some users.
  • Comprehensive Project Management
    Workgroups DaVinci offers an extensive suite of project management tools, including task assignment, tracking, and timelines, which help in efficiently managing projects from conception to completion.
  • Collaboration Features
    The platform facilitates robust collaboration among team members through features like centralized communication, shared workspaces, and easy document sharing, enhancing productivity.
  • Customization Options
    Users can tailor the software to meet their specific workflow needs, thanks to its flexible customization options, which allow for creating custom workflows, forms, and reports.
  • Integrated Proofing and Approvals
    The integrated proofing and approval tools streamline the review process, enabling quick feedback and faster approvals, thus reducing bottlenecks in project workflows.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The software boasts an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, making it easier for users to get accustomed to the system without extensive training.

Possible disadvantages

  • Price
    Workgroups DaVinci can be relatively expensive, making it potentially less accessible for small businesses or startups with limited budgets.
  • Learning Curve
    Despite its user-friendly interface, the extensive features and customization options may present a steep learning curve for new users or teams transitioning from simpler tools.
  • Limited Integrations
    The platform may have limited integrations with some third-party applications, which could be a drawback for teams that rely heavily on other software solutions.
  • Customer Support
    Some users report that customer support can be slow to respond, which could delay resolving urgent issues affecting project timelines.
  • Mobile App Limitations
    The mobile app version has fewer features compared to the desktop version, which might hamper productivity for users who need full functionality on the go.
